In Case You Were Wondering What Happened To Michael Jackson’s Animals…

mjpoint.jpg 

…as we were wondering one day on BTR Today, here’s your answer:

Voices of the Wild Foundation, a non-profit organization based in remote Page, Ariz.., that provides sanctuary to abandoned exotic animals, has adopted the bulk of Jacko’s zoo — including four giraffes, nine parrots and three giant pythons.

Two caymans and two anacondas (now living in Oklahoma) from the King of Pop’s pet collection are also set to join the herd in the coming months. (No [Bubbles] the Chimp, though — he, of course, passed away years ago.)

Apparently the animlas are living in temporary quarters now, but permanent homes are currently being built for them.  It seems they arrived healthy and not showing signs of mistreatment.  In 2006, the entertainer was cleared in an animal neglect investigation, after PETA lodged a complaint saying the animals were suffering.
